Overview
MetaDesign Solutions partnered with SharkNinja to develop a custom Photoshop plug-in supporting both Windows and Mac environments. The solution automated complex file renaming and storage processes based on intricate entity relationships, significantly enhancing creative workflow efficiency.
In addition, a scalable admin panel hosted on AWS was developed to manage entity relationships in real time, providing a centralized and robust management system.
Client challenges
Before implementation, SharkNinja faced several operational and technical challenges:
- Automating file renaming based on complex parameter combinations (super brand, category, product, etc.)
- Ensuring seamless compatibility across Windows and Mac operating systems
- Managing intricate entity relationships in real time
- Designing a scalable backend to handle high volumes of file data
- Hosting the admin panel securely within SharkNinja’s AWS infrastructure
- Minimizing manual file errors and improving operational consistency
Objectives
The primary objectives of the project were to:
- Develop a cross-platform Photoshop plug-in
- Automate file naming and storage workflows
- Create a centralized admin system for managing entity logic
- Ensure scalable and secure backend architecture
- Improve efficiency for creative teams
- Reduce manual errors in file management processes
Solution approach
MetaDesign Solutions designed and developed a UXP-based Photoshop plug-in integrated with the Photoshop SDK.
Key components included:
- Automated file renaming and storage logic
- Cross-platform UXP implementation for Windows and Mac
- AWS-hosted admin panel for managing entity relationships
- MERN stack backend for scalability and flexibility
- ReactJS-based intuitive UI for administrators
The integration between plug-in and admin panel ensured consistent logic application across creative workflows.
Implementation process
The implementation was carried out in clearly defined stages:
- Cross-Platform Plug-in Development
Built a UXP-based Photoshop plug-in compatible across Windows and Mac environments to eliminate platform inconsistencies. - Entity Logic Automation
Developed advanced parameter-based renaming logic to automate file structuring and eliminate manual intervention. - AWS Infrastructure Deployment
Deployed a secure and scalable admin panel within SharkNinja’s AWS environment for centralized management. - Backend Architecture
Implemented MERN stack architecture to support scalable data processing and entity relationship management. - Testing & Optimization
Performed cross-platform validation and workflow stress testing to ensure reliability and performance.
Results
The solution delivered immediate value to SharkNinja’s creative teams by:
- Automating repetitive file management tasks
- Reducing manual errors in naming and storage
- Improving productivity and workflow efficiency
- Enabling scalable and centralized entity management
- Ensuring consistent performance across platforms
The custom Photoshop plug-in and AWS-based admin panel significantly enhanced creative operations, reinforcing MetaDesign Solutions’ expertise in Adobe plug-in development and enterprise workflow automation.